Just what is the promise?
We’ve all got an idea of substance and achievement, even if we don’t all agree. But if there is a promise, maybe it is not a matter of agreement, but more a matter of recognition. So, is there an essence common to all, and does that essence hold a promise?
Good grief, an age-old question attempted to be answered in a page more or less? Actually less by now—all these digressions you know. Certainly the question has been answered before, in both clear and obscure ways. But revisiting the question and the answer to the question, is an essential activity central to both question and answer. All right, it seems like I’m headed towards the obscure way.
Let’s try this: If we let go of everything in our minds, hold on to no thing, we are still left with something. All of us. I’ll call it awareness. I’m not arguing degrees here, I’m stating the essential essence, the Great Permeator—that which flows through all of us to one degree or another, regardless of what we are, have, or know.
For each of us individually and for all of us communally, we have this home. This home is the promise—it is the base. We may gain or lose degrees of it, but while we are alive anyway (in this manner I get to avoid all the pre- and post-physical assertions), we cannot be totally voided of some form of awareness. And that’s why it’s a promise. Admittedly, it’s a funny kind of promise since it is always changing, but a promise it is since some form of it will always be there for us.
So, when you want to achieve something, what and where is the best place to not only start, but to check into from time to time? Home. Don’t create from a creation, create from home. Since home changes, commensurate with our degree of awareness, it is always the best place to check in to see where one is really at. And the most efficient way to get somewhere, is to know where one is at to begin with. That’s the best each of us can do, and that makes it a rock-solid contribution to ourselves and to the tribe—each and every time, and regardless of our degree of awareness.
Not a bad promise, not a bad place (though awareness is not like a place). It seems like the promise and the home are rock solid. Now we just have to quit ignoring the connection and confusing the digressions, entertainments, and dramas of our awareness as our home—though the digressions, like my playing at the beginning of this musing, can be lots of fun (okay—maybe fun for some).
